> I am planning the upgrade of 2 production clustered Integrity servers from 8.3 to 8.4 and would like to run a few things by you for any comments you may wish to offer.

> The servers boot from their own local copies of VMS and use a SAN disk as a quorum disk.

> SYLOGICALS has been modified so that the cluster logical names point to an area on the SAN disk, thereby unifying UAF, etc.

> From reading the upgrade notes it would seem that this is an area of risk and recommends that I copy the files to their original locations before attempting the upgrade. Can anyone confirm if this is indeed a requirement? Also, do I need to alter SYLOGICALS to reflect this change? Presumably following the upgrade, I would then copy the 'updated' versions of the files back to the SAN drive?

> Order of upgrade. What is recommended here? Power both down, upgrade both then boot both? Or, power down one, upgrade and reboot then repeat for the second server?
